public static UnitaMisura GetOrCreate(Session session, string codice) { var u = session.FindObject <UnitaMisura>(new BinaryOperator(nameof(Codice), codice)); if (u == null) { u = new UnitaMisura(session); } u.Codice = codice; return(u); }
public override void AfterConstruction() { base.AfterConstruction(); UnitaMisura = UnitaMisura.GetOrCreate(Session, "Nr"); }